When iron rusts it is being?

1) converted to gold
2) oxidized
3) reduced
4) neutralized

Final answer:

When iron rusts, it is being oxidized. The process involves the oxidation of iron to form iron (II) ions, which further react with water and oxygen to produce rust.

Step-by-step explanation:

When iron rusts, it is being oxidized. The process of rusting involves the oxidation of iron to form iron (II) ions, which then further react with water and oxygen to produce hydrated iron (III) oxide, known as rust. Rusting is an example of corrosion, which is the deterioration of metals through redox processes.
